'''The Amazing Spider-Man''' is a [[platformer]] starring the Marvel comic book character Spider-Man. The game was developed by {{c|Oxford Digital Enterprises|Oxford Digital Enterprises Ltd.}}, and released in [[1990]] for the [[Amiga]], and later ported to [[DOS]], [[Commodore 64]], and [[Atari ST]]. The title was published by [[Paragon Software]]. | |||
Mysterio has kidnapped Mary-Jane, leaving only a note telling Peter Parker to have Spider-Man show up at the old movie studios or he will never see Mary-Jane again. Peter Parker dons Spider-Man's uniform and shows up at the studio only to be knocked out and left somewhere else in the studio, his spider-senses temporary paralyzed. Mysterio's voice booms out over the studios challenging Spider-Man to brave the movie studios and break through his defenses to save Mary-Jane. | |||
